Quality Assessment
Emrock’s quality grade is assessed as average. The company’s management efficiency is a key concern, with a Return on Equity (ROE) averaging a low 0.96%. This figure indicates that the company generates less than ₹1 of profit for every ₹100 of shareholders’ equity, signalling limited profitability. Despite this, the company maintains a very low debt-to-equity ratio of 0.01 times, suggesting minimal financial leverage and a conservative capital structure. However, the operating profit growth over the past five years has been modest, at an annualised rate of 19.53%, which is below what might be expected for a high-growth FMCG player.
Valuation Considerations
The valuation of Emrock Corporation Limited is currently very expensive. The stock trades at a Price to Book Value (P/BV) ratio of 30.7, which is significantly higher than typical sector averages and indicates a premium pricing by the market. This elevated valuation is not fully supported by the company’s fundamentals, given the low ROE and flat financial results. Investors should be cautious, as paying a high premium for a stock with limited profitability and growth prospects may increase downside risk if performance does not improve.
Financial Trend Analysis
The financial trend for Emrock is characterised as flat. The company’s quarterly earnings per share (EPS) reached a low of ₹0.12 in June 2026, reflecting subdued profitability. While the stock’s profits have reportedly risen by 96% over the past year, this has not translated into a commensurate improvement in returns or operational efficiency. The flat trend suggests that the company is currently in a consolidation phase, with limited momentum to drive significant growth or margin expansion in the near term.
